Attic Water Damage Repair in Denver County, CO
Attic water damage repair services address issues caused by leaks, condensation, or plumbing failures that result in water intrusion into attic spaces. These projects typically involve removing standing water, drying affected areas, and repairing or replacing damaged insulation, drywall, and structural components. Homeowners often seek this service to prevent further deterioration, mold growth, and structural issues that can compromise the safety and integrity of the home.
Before requesting attic water damage repair, property owners should understand the extent of the damage, including whether it has affected insulation, electrical wiring, or structural elements. It is also helpful to identify the source of the water intrusion to prevent future problems. Clear communication about the scope of the damage and any visible signs of mold or ongoing leaks can assist in planning effective repairs and ensuring the attic remains dry and secure.

Attic Water Damage Repair Questions
What causes attic water damage? Water damage in attics can result from leaks, roof issues, or plumbing problems that allow moisture to enter and accumulate.
How can water damage in the attic be identified? Signs include water stains, mold growth, musty odors, and visible dampness or discoloration on ceiling and roof structures.
What are common repairs needed for attic water damage? Repairs often involve removing damaged insulation, drying affected areas, fixing leaks, and restoring or replacing damaged roof components.
Why is prompt water damage repair important? Addressing water damage quickly helps prevent mold growth, structural deterioration, and further property issues.
